Carcès is located in Green Provence, on a hill, at the confluence of the Argens and Caramy rivers. Carcès boasts a rich historical heritage with its medieval centre. It also benefits from a 100 ha lake and numerous rivers which make Carcès a popular centre for fresh water fishing. Carcès is located northeast of Brignoles (15 km) and 60 km from the Mediterranean beaches (Fréjus, St Raphaël, Ste Maxime), and is surrounded by prestigious neighbouring villages like Le Thoronet (Abbey) and Cotignac a lovely village with narrow streets and numerous fountains at the foot of a majestic rock with waterfall.
Environment : Within easy reach of Lake Carcès and 8 km of shores (ideal for fishing!). Rivers, forested hills, vineyards are Carcès environment.
PLACES TO VISIT:
Entrecasteaux. 10 km. Pretty and unspoilt village with medieval streets and typical pastel painted houses. The village is overlooked by its chateau.
Salernes. 20 km. Medieval town built around its castle, in a picturesque setting in the valley of the Bresque river. Best known for its tradition of tile making, especially for the trademark terracotta hexagonal floor tiles of Provence.
Lorgues. 20 km. Small and very pleasant medieval town with a maze of old streets, open squares and fountains, surrounded by vineyards and olive trees.
Aups. 25 km. Pretty Provencal hill top village overlooked by the remains of its medieval castle. Its weekly markets are famous including its winter truffle markets.
THINGS TO DO:
Golf de Barbaroux, Brignoles. 17 km. Golf course. 18 holes Par 72 - 6068m. One of Europe’s most prestigious golf courses, a magnificent wooded landscape in a stunning setting, surrounded by vineyards and Mediterranean pine trees covering the hillsides. An essential golfing experience.
Aoubré - L'Aventure Nature, Flassans-sur-Issole. 20 km. Tree top adventure park. A park for the whole family with trails adapted for all ages and abilities. In total, 7 different trails offering 105 workshops. Also do not miss the visit of the small farm with large enclosures. Allow the whole day to make the most of it.
Provence Aventure, Vidauban. 30 km. Tree top adventure park. A beautiful setting, in the heart of an oak forest, on the banks of the Argens River. Different trails for the whole family (from the age of 3) according to ages and abilities including for the fearless ones a 200m-long zip line crossing the Argens river. A refreshing experience!
Ste Croix lake. 45 km. The largest of the Verdon lakes and lovely spot for splashing about. Also boat, pedalo and kayak hire.
FURTHER AFIELD:
Flayosc. 25 km. Pretty town with typical Provencal streets and great views from the church out across the vineyards.
Tourtour. 30 km. Also called the village in the sky. Medieval hilltop village with plenty of narrow streets lined with very picturesque Provencal houses.
Draguignan. 35 km. Pleasant town once a military centre but now with tourist and cultural attractions. Lovely avenues lined with plane trees surround the old city. Excellent shopping and markets. Several museums.
Gorges du Verdon. 40 km. Europe’s largest river canyon and one of France’s greatest natural wonder with twisting narrow roads, dramatic scenery, awesome views but also lofty little villages and chapels clinging to the rocks. THE place for climbing, rafting, canyoning, kayaking...
